Backend Developer - Engine Team


  • Design and build a system that controls fleets of robots
  • Work with and devise algorithms that optimize resource management and task allocation
  • Work across our multi-tier architecture, from coding robots, on-premises service and cross-site service


  • 4+ years of experience with an object-oriented programming language.
  • Experience in at least one programming languages Java, C/C++, C#, Objective C, Python, JavaScript, or Go.
  • Software development experience in one or more general purpose programming languages.
  • Experience working with web application development, Unix/Linux environments.
  • Experience in machine learning, information retrieval, and networking - in advance.
  • Experience in cross-platform developing, responsive web development and mobile adjusting - in advance.
  • Robotics background - in advance

Please complete the form below